Skip to main content

Pega Blueprint and DevOps

In today’s digital landscape, organizations must deliver high-quality applications rapidly. Application architects need tools and methodologies that streamline the development lifecycle while maintaining architectural integrity. Pega Blueprint addresses this need by transforming how teams design, develop, and deploy Pega applications.

Pega Blueprint™ is a generative AI-powered, collaborative design tool within Pega Platform™. As a 'design-as-a-service' tool, Blueprint transforms the traditionally manual and disconnected application design process into a dynamic, collaborative experience. Teams can describe an application’s purpose in plain language, and Pega’s AI systems generate a comprehensive, interactive application blueprint.

Blueprint accelerates the initial phases of requirement gathering and documentation, providing a solid foundation for development. It can also ingest legacy business process models, documentation, and application screens, supporting the modernization of existing systems.

Expediting application deployment

Pega Blueprint significantly accelerates application deployment by:

  • Reducing design cycles: Projects that previously required weeks or months for design can now begin with a solid foundation in minutes or hours. This allows architects to focus on strategic design and integration.
  • Seamless integration with App Studio: The generated blueprint is not static; it can be imported into App Studio to automatically generate the application’s structure, enabling rapid development and refinement.
  • Embedding best practices: Blueprint incorporates Pega’s industry best practices, ensuring that initial designs adhere to recommended guardrails and design patterns for higher quality and maintainability.
  • Supporting modernization: Blueprint’s ability to analyze legacy artifacts provides a clear, accelerated path for modernization initiatives.

Pega Blueprint and the DevOps pipeline

A successful DevOps culture is built on collaboration, automation, and speed. Pega Blueprint is a natural fit for this philosophy, helping to bridge the gap between business and IT and automating the 'first mile' of application development. 

  • Providing high-quality CI/CD inputs: Well-structured, validated designs from Blueprint improve the reliability of Continuous Integration/Continuous Deployment (CI/CD) pipelines, reducing downstream errors. 
  • Fostering collaboration: Blueprint offers a shared visual language for business and technical teams, supporting cross-functional collaboration central to DevOps. 
  • Automating initial development: Automating much of the upfront design and documentation enables teams to move quickly to coding and configuration. 
  • Integrating with Pega DevOps tools: Applications designed in Blueprint can be managed and deployed using Pega Deployment Manager, supporting end-to-end, low-code automation for CI/CD pipelines.

Best practices of using Pega Blueprint in application deployment

To get the most out of Pega Blueprint, architects should consider the following best practices:

  • Start with a clear vision: The quality of the AI-generated blueprint depends on the clarity and completeness of your initial description. Clearly define the application’s purpose, problems to solve, and desired outcomes. 
  • Collaborate and iterate: Use Blueprint’s collaborative features to work with business analysts and stakeholders, refining and improving the design iteratively. 
  • Apply Blueprint to new and existing applications: Blueprint’s ability to import and analyze legacy documentation makes it valuable for both new projects and modernization efforts. 
  • Focus on Microjourneys® and business outcomes: Design applications around specific business outcomes and the Microjourneys® that achieve them for more targeted, effective solutions.
     

Check your knowledge with the following interaction:


This Topic is available in the following Module:

If you are having problems with your training, please review the Pega Academy Support FAQs.

Did you find this content helpful?

Want to help us improve this content?

We'd prefer it if you saw us at our best.

Pega Academy has detected you are using a browser which may prevent you from experiencing the site as intended. To improve your experience, please update your browser.

Close Deprecation Notice